MODULE 1: Layout Architecture
1.1 The Generous Frame
Rule: Default to more whitespace than feels comfortable. Then add 20% more.
.section {
padding: clamp(4rem, 10vh, 8rem) clamp(1.5rem, 5vw, 4rem);
}
.reading-column {
max-width: 72ch;
}
.gap-sm { gap: 1rem; }
.gap-md { gap: 2rem; }
.gap-lg { gap: 4rem; }
.gap-xl { gap: 8rem; }
Why: Dense interfaces signal haste. Generous spacing signals confidence and invites focus.
1.2 Asymmetric Balance
Rule: Center alignment is a last resort. Use asymmetric layouts to create visual interest and guide reading flow.
.asymmetric-grid {
display: grid;
grid-template-columns: 1fr 1.618fr;
gap: 4rem;
}
.offset-block {
margin-left: 15%;
max-width: 55%;
}
.hanging-element {
position: relative;
left: -2rem;
}
1.3 The Reading Line
Rule: Establish a clear vertical reading line. All primary content should align to this invisible axis.
.reading-line {
padding-left: 0;
border-left: none;
}
.callout {
margin-left: -1.5rem;
padding-left: 1.25rem;
border-left: 3px solid var(--color-accent);
}
1.4 Layered Depth (Not Flat)
Rule: Use subtle depth to create hierarchy without shadows that feel "material."
.surface-1 { background: var(--color-bg); }
.surface-2 { background: var(--color-surface); }
.surface-3 { background: var(--color-elevated); }
.colored-shadow {
box-shadow: 0 4px 24px -4px var(--color-shadow);
}
1.5 The Focal Point
Rule: Every section needs ONE focal point. Not two. Not zero. One.
Techniques:
- Scale contrast (hero text vs body)
- Color isolation (single accent in monochrome field)
- Negative space framing
- Typographic weight contrast
1.6 Content-First Breakpoints
Rule: Breakpoints follow content, not devices.
@media (min-width: 60ch) { }
@media (min-width: 90ch) { }
@media (min-width: 120ch) { }
MODULE 2: Typography System
2.1 Type Scale: The Minor Third
Rule: Use a musical scale for type. The minor third (1.2 ratio) creates harmonious, readable hierarchy.
:root {
--text-xs: clamp(0.75rem, 0.7rem + 0.25vw, 0.875rem);
--text-sm: clamp(0.875rem, 0.8rem + 0.35vw, 1rem);
--text-base: clamp(1rem, 0.9rem + 0.5vw, 1.125rem);
--text-lg: clamp(1.125rem, 1rem + 0.65vw, 1.375rem);
--text-xl: clamp(1.25rem, 1.1rem + 0.75vw, 1.75rem);
--text-2xl: clamp(1.5rem, 1.2rem + 1.5vw, 2.5rem);
--text-3xl: clamp(1.875rem, 1.3rem + 2.5vw, 3.5rem);
--text-4xl: clamp(2.25rem, 1.5rem + 3.5vw, 5rem);
--leading-tight: 1.1;
--leading-snug: 1.25;
--leading-normal: 1.5;
--leading-relaxed: 1.65;
--leading-loose: 1.8;
}
2.2 Font Pairing Philosophy
Rule: Pair a distinctive display face with a highly readable body face. Never use the same font for both.
Recommended pairings for AI interfaces:
| Display | Body | Mood |
|---|
| Source Serif 4 | Source Sans 3 | Scholarly, trustworthy |
| Newsreader | Inter | Editorial, refined |
| Cormorant Garamond | Work Sans | Elegant, generous |
| Literata | DM Sans | Literary, warm |
| Playfair Display | Source Sans 3 | Classic authority |
2.3 The Paragraph as Object
Rule: Treat paragraphs as visual objects, not just text containers.
.prose {
font-size: var(--text-base);
line-height: var(--leading-relaxed);
color: var(--color-text);
p + p {
margin-top: 1.5em;
}
h2 + p, h3 + p {
margin-top: 0.75em;
}
> p:first-of-type::first-letter {
float: left;
font-size: 3.5em;
line-height: 0.8;
padding-right: 0.1em;
font-weight: 700;
color: var(--color-accent);
}
}
2.4 Typographic Color
Rule: Use weight and color to create typographic "color" (visual density), not just size.
h1, h2 {
font-weight: 400;
letter-spacing: -0.02em;
color: var(--color-text);
}
body {
font-weight: 400;
color: var(--color-text-secondary);
}
strong {
font-weight: 600;
color: var(--color-text);
}
2.5 Code & Monospace
Rule: Code should feel integrated, not alien.
code {
font-family: 'SF Mono', 'JetBrains Mono', monospace;
font-size: 0.9em;
padding: 0.15em 0.4em;
background: var(--color-surface);
border-radius: 4px;
color: var(--color-text);
}
pre {
padding: 1.5rem;
background: var(--color-surface);
border-radius: 12px;
overflow-x: auto;
line-height: 1.6;
}
pre code {
padding: 0;
background: none;
}
MODULE 3: Color System
3.1 The Muted Foundation
Rule: Start with muted, sophisticated base colors. Reserve saturation for intentional moments.
:root {
--color-bg: #FAFAF8;
--color-surface: #F5F5F0;
--color-elevated: #FFFFFF;
--color-text: #1C1917;
--color-text-secondary: #57534E;
--color-text-tertiary: #A8A29E;
--color-border: #E7E5E4;
--color-accent: #D97706;
--color-accent-subtle: #FEF3C7;
}
@media (prefers-color-scheme: dark) {
:root {
--color-bg: #0C0A09;
--color-surface: #1C1917;
--color-elevated: #292524;
--color-text: #FAFAF9;
--color-text-secondary: #A8A29E;
--color-text-tertiary: #57534E;
--color-border: #292524;
--color-accent: #F59E0B;
--color-accent-subtle: #451A03;
}
}
3.2 Color Psychology for AI Interfaces
| Color | Use Case | Avoid |
|---|
| Warm amber | Primary actions, AI presence | Error states |
| Sage green | Success, completion, calm | Urgent actions |
| Dusty rose | Warnings, caution | Primary branding |
| Stone gray | Neutral info, secondary | CTAs |
| Deep charcoal | Text, authority | Backgrounds |
3.3 Semantic Color Application
.btn-primary {
background: var(--color-accent);
color: var(--color-bg);
}
.btn-secondary {
background: transparent;
border: 1px solid var(--color-border);
color: var(--color-text);
}
.status-success { color: #65A30D; }
.status-warning { color: #CA8A04; }
.status-error { color: #DC2626; }
.status-info { color: #0891B2; }
.status-thinking {
color: var(--color-accent);
animation: pulse 2s ease-in-out infinite;
}
.status-generating {
background: linear-gradient(90deg, var(--color-accent), transparent);
background-size: 200% 100%;
animation: shimmer 1.5s ease-in-out infinite;
}
MODULE 4: Component Patterns
4.1 The Conversation Thread
The core pattern for AI chat interfaces.
interface MessageProps {
role: 'user' | 'assistant';
content: string;
timestamp: Date;
isStreaming?: boolean;
}
export const Message = ({ role, content, timestamp, isStreaming }: MessageProps) => {
return (
<div className={cn(
"flex gap-4 py-6",
role === 'assistant' && "bg-[var(--color-surface)]"
)}>
<div className="flex-shrink-0 w-8 h-8 rounded-full flex items-center justify-center text-sm font-medium
{role === 'user'
? 'bg-[var(--color-text)] text-[var(--color-bg)]'
: 'bg-[var(--color-accent)] text-[var(--color-bg)]'}"
>
{role === 'user' ? 'U' : 'A'}
</div>
<div className="flex-1 min-w-0">
<div className="flex items-center gap-2 mb-1">
<span className="text-sm font-medium text-[var(--color-text)]">
{role === 'user' ? 'You' : 'Claude'}
</span>
<span className="text-xs text-[var(--color-text-tertiary)]">
{formatTime(timestamp)}
</span>
</div>
<div className="prose prose-sm max-w-none text-[var(--color-text-secondary)]">
<Markdown content={content} />
{isStreaming && <span className="inline-block w-2 h-4 bg-[var(--color-accent)] animate-pulse ml-1" />}
</div>
{role === 'assistant' && !isStreaming && (
<div className="flex gap-2 mt-3">
<button className="text-xs text-[var(--color-text-tertiary)] hover:text-[var(--color-text)] transition-colors">
Copy
</button>
<button className="text-xs text-[var(--color-text-tertiary)] hover:text-[var(--color-text)] transition-colors">
Retry
</button>
</div>
)}
</div>
</div>
);
};
4.2 The Thinking Indicator
Transparency builds trust. Show when the AI is "thinking."
export const ThinkingIndicator = () => {
return (
<div className="flex items-center gap-3 py-4 text-[var(--color-text-tertiary)]">
<div className="flex gap-1">
<span className="w-2 h-2 rounded-full bg-[var(--color-accent)] animate-bounce" style={{ animationDelay: '0ms' }} />
<span className="w-2 h-2 rounded-full bg-[var(--color-accent)] animate-bounce" style={{ animationDelay: '150ms' }} />
<span className="w-2 h-2 rounded-full bg-[var(--color-accent)] animate-bounce" style={{ animationDelay: '300ms' }} />
</div>
<span className="text-sm">Claude is thinking...</span>
</div>
);
};

MODULE 5: Motion & Interaction
5.1 Motion Philosophy
Rule: Motion should feel like thought, not entertainment.
| Good Motion | Bad Motion |
|---|
| Fade in (content appearing) | Bounce in (playful, distracting) |
| Subtle scale on press | Shake on error (aggressive) |
| Smooth height transitions | Jarring layout shifts |
| Cursor blink (human) | Spinning loaders (machine) |
| Staggered list reveals | Everything animating at once |
5.2 Timing Tokens
:root {
--duration-instant: 0ms;
--duration-fast: 150ms;
--duration-normal: 250ms;
--duration-slow: 400ms;
--duration-deliberate: 600ms;
--ease-smooth: cubic-bezier(0.4, 0, 0.2, 1);
--ease-spring: cubic-bezier(0.34, 1.56, 0.64, 1);
--ease-expo: cubic-bezier(0.16, 1, 0.3, 1);
}
5.3 The Thoughtful Entrance
@keyframes appear {
from {
opacity: 0;
transform: translateY(8px);
}
to {
opacity: 1;
transform: translateY(0);
}
}
.appear {
animation: appear var(--duration-normal) var(--ease-expo) forwards;
}
.stagger-children > * {
opacity: 0;
animation: appear var(--duration-normal) var(--ease-expo) forwards;
}
.stagger-children > *:nth-child(1) { animation-delay: 0ms; }
.stagger-children > *:nth-child(2) { animation-delay: 50ms; }
.stagger-children > *:nth-child(3) { animation-delay: 100ms; }
.stagger-children > *:nth-child(4) { animation-delay: 150ms; }
.stagger-children > *:nth-child(5) { animation-delay: 200ms; }
5.4 The Generous Hover
.interactive {
transition: transform var(--duration-fast) var(--ease-smooth),
background-color var(--duration-fast) var(--ease-smooth);
}
.interactive:hover {
transform: translateY(-1px);
}
.interactive:active {
transform: translateY(0) scale(0.98);
}
a {
text-decoration: none;
border-bottom: 1px solid transparent;
transition: border-color var(--duration-fast) var(--ease-smooth);
}
a:hover {
border-bottom-color: currentColor;
}
5.5 Streaming Text Animation
@keyframes cursor-blink {
0%, 100% { opacity: 1; }
50% { opacity: 0; }
}
.streaming-cursor {
display: inline-block;
width: 2px;
height: 1.2em;
background: var(--color-accent);
margin-left: 2px;
vertical-align: text-bottom;
animation: cursor-blink 1s step-end infinite;
}
.streaming-word {
animation: appear var(--duration-fast) var(--ease-smooth) forwards;
}

MODULE 8: Anti-Patterns
8.1 The Confidence Checklist
Before shipping, verify NONE of these are present:
| Anti-Pattern | Why It Kills Trust | Fix |
|---|
| Fake typing delay | Manipulative, wastes time | Stream real tokens or show instantly |
| "I'm just an AI" disclaimers | Undermines confidence | Show capabilities, not limitations |
| Unsolicited suggestions | Feels pushy | Wait for user to ask |
| Over-confident wrong answers | Destroys trust | Use uncertainty signals |
| Dark patterns in pricing | Violates trust | Transparent, simple pricing |
| Hidden AI involvement | Deceptive | Clear AI attribution |
| Infinite scroll without save | Anxiety-inducing | Clear session boundaries |
| No way to stop generation | Loss of control | Prominent stop button |
8.2 The Tone Check
Read the interface aloud. If it sounds like:
- A corporate memo → Rewrite
- A Terms of Service → Rewrite
- A motivational poster → Rewrite
- A thoughtful email → Keep
